A general view of the Isokon Flats, a block of apartments that is part of an experiment in minimalist living, is being shown in London, United Kingdom, on January 26, 2024. Celebrated residents have included Bauhaus emigres Walter Gropius, Marcel Breuer, and Laszlo Moholy-Nagy; architects Egon Riss and Arthur Korn; writer Agatha Christie and her husband Max Mallowan from 1941 to 1947; art historian Adrian Stokes; author Nicholas Monsarrat; archaeologist V. Gordon Childe; modernist architect Jacques Groag and his wife, textile designer Jacqueline Groag.
